1
0
Fork 0
mirror of https://github.com/git/git.git synced 2024-11-04 16:27:54 +01:00
git/Documentation
Thomas Rast f5f1e164bd Document 'stash clear' recovery via unreachable commits
Add an example to the stash documentation that shows how to quickly
find candidate commits among the 'git fsck --unreachable' output.
Unless you have merges of branch names containing WIP, or edit your
merge messages to say WIP, there will be no false positives.

Snippet written by Björn "doener" Steinbrink and me after zepolen_
asked on IRC.

Signed-off-by: Thomas Rast <trast@student.ethz.ch>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
2009-08-09 18:33:41 -07:00
..
howto Documentation: Typo / spelling / formatting fixes 2009-03-03 21:43:19 -08:00
pt_BR Fix typos on pt_BR/gittutorial.txt translation 2009-07-31 11:24:18 -07:00
technical technical-docs: document tree-walking API 2009-08-03 22:42:14 -07:00
.gitattributes
.gitignore
asciidoc.conf git-submodule documentation: fix foreach example 2009-06-30 11:17:54 -07:00
blame-options.txt Merge branch 'dm/maint-docco' 2009-03-21 23:24:46 -07:00
build-docdep.perl
cat-texi.perl
cmd-list.perl
CodingGuidelines
config.txt config.txt: document add.ignore-errors 2009-07-28 23:56:01 -07:00
diff-format.txt Update the documentation of the raw diff output format 2009-07-28 13:32:59 -07:00
diff-generate-patch.txt
diff-options.txt doc: clarify how -S works 2009-03-19 02:47:40 -07:00
docbook-xsl.css docbook: change css style 2009-04-06 00:27:09 -07:00
docbook.xsl
everyday.txt everyday: use the dashless form of git-init 2009-03-22 10:33:36 -07:00
fetch-options.txt
fix-texi.perl
git-add.txt Merge branch 'js/add-edit' 2009-05-18 09:00:06 -07:00
git-am.txt am, rebase: teach quiet option 2009-06-18 11:54:48 -07:00
git-annotate.txt Documentation: minor grammatical fixes. 2009-03-02 12:34:54 -08:00
git-apply.txt git-apply(1): Clarify that one can select where to apply the patch 2009-05-31 15:39:04 -07:00
git-archimport.txt
git-archive.txt archive: do not read .gitattributes in working directory 2009-04-17 21:05:49 -07:00
git-bisect.txt Documentation: remove warning saying that "git bisect skip" may slow bisection 2009-06-13 10:48:59 -07:00
git-blame.txt Documentation: minor grammatical fixes in git-blame.txt. 2009-03-17 12:08:43 -07:00
git-branch.txt allow -t abbreviation for --track in git branch 2009-05-09 08:32:14 -07:00
git-bundle.txt Documentation: minor grammatical fixes and rewording in git-bundle.txt 2009-03-22 20:59:20 -07:00
git-cat-file.txt fix cat-file usage message and documentation 2009-05-25 12:08:15 -07:00
git-check-attr.txt Documentation: minor grammatical fixes in git-check-attr.txt 2009-03-22 21:02:38 -07:00
git-check-ref-format.txt Merge branch 'rr/forbid-bs-in-ref' 2009-05-23 01:39:45 -07:00
git-checkout-index.txt
git-checkout.txt docs/checkout: clarify what "non-branch" means 2009-04-13 09:08:16 -07:00
git-cherry-pick.txt
git-cherry.txt
git-citool.txt
git-clean.txt git-clean doc: the command only affects paths under $(cwd) 2009-05-06 10:51:34 -07:00
git-clone.txt Documentation: cloning to empty directory is allowed 2009-05-09 01:28:08 -07:00
git-commit-tree.txt
git-commit.txt
git-config.txt git config: clarify --add and --get-color 2009-05-09 00:19:25 -07:00
git-count-objects.txt
git-cvsexportcommit.txt Add -k option to cvsexportcommit to revert expanded CVS keywords in CVS working tree before applying commit patch 2009-06-18 10:19:50 -07:00
git-cvsimport.txt Documentation: fix typos / spelling mistakes 2009-04-20 15:56:07 -07:00
git-cvsserver.txt
git-daemon.txt Merge branch 'maint-1.6.0' into maint-1.6.1 2009-04-18 14:43:24 -07:00
git-describe.txt
git-diff-files.txt Update the documentation of the raw diff output format 2009-07-28 13:32:59 -07:00
git-diff-index.txt Update the documentation of the raw diff output format 2009-07-28 13:32:59 -07:00
git-diff-tree.txt Update the documentation of the raw diff output format 2009-07-28 13:32:59 -07:00
git-diff.txt Update the documentation of the raw diff output format 2009-07-28 13:32:59 -07:00
git-difftool.txt mergetool--lib: add support for araxis merge 2009-05-24 11:21:05 -07:00
git-fast-export.txt git fast-export: add --no-data option 2009-07-31 07:48:09 -07:00
git-fast-import.txt
git-fetch-pack.txt
git-fetch.txt
git-filter-branch.txt Merge branch 'maint' 2009-04-12 16:01:25 -07:00
git-fmt-merge-msg.txt
git-for-each-ref.txt for-each-ref: utilize core.warnAmbiguousRefs for :short-format 2009-04-13 09:36:52 -07:00
git-format-patch.txt Improve doc for format-patch threading options. 2009-07-22 21:57:41 -07:00
git-fsck-objects.txt
git-fsck.txt
git-gc.txt gc: make --prune useful again by accepting an optional parameter 2009-02-14 21:14:07 -08:00
git-get-tar-commit-id.txt
git-grep.txt grep -p: support user defined regular expressions 2009-07-01 19:16:50 -07:00
git-gui.txt
git-hash-object.txt
git-help.txt
git-http-fetch.txt
git-http-push.txt
git-imap-send.txt Merge branch 'maint' 2009-04-18 14:45:59 -07:00
git-index-pack.txt
git-init-db.txt init-db: migrate to parse-options 2009-07-12 14:36:40 -07:00
git-init.txt git init: optionally allow a directory argument 2009-07-25 02:17:54 -07:00
git-instaweb.txt
git-log.txt
git-lost-found.txt
git-ls-files.txt git-ls-files.txt: clarify what "other files" mean for --other 2009-08-06 14:01:13 -07:00
git-ls-remote.txt
git-ls-tree.txt Merge branch 'maint-1.6.1' into maint-1.6.2 2009-05-13 21:06:11 -07:00
git-mailinfo.txt
git-mailsplit.txt
git-merge-base.txt git-merge-base/git-show-branch --merge-base: Documentation and test 2009-08-05 10:29:37 -07:00
git-merge-file.txt
git-merge-index.txt
git-merge-one-file.txt
git-merge-tree.txt
git-merge.txt Grammar fix for "git merge" man page 2009-03-26 09:38:58 -07:00
git-mergetool--lib.txt mergetool--lib: simplify API usage by removing more global variables 2009-04-12 15:19:12 -07:00
git-mergetool.txt mergetool--lib: add support for araxis merge 2009-05-24 11:21:05 -07:00
git-mktag.txt
git-mktree.txt mktree --batch: build more than one tree object 2009-05-16 10:28:59 -07:00
git-mv.txt
git-name-rev.txt
git-pack-objects.txt git repack: keep commits hidden by a graft 2009-07-24 09:10:16 -07:00
git-pack-redundant.txt
git-pack-refs.txt doc/git-pack-refs: fix two grammar issues 2009-04-05 00:39:37 -07:00
git-parse-remote.txt parse-remote: remove unused functions 2009-06-11 19:50:45 -07:00
git-patch-id.txt Grammar fixes to "merge" and "patch-id" docs 2009-03-25 17:28:33 -07:00
git-peek-remote.txt
git-prune-packed.txt prune-packed: migrate to parse-options 2009-07-10 23:57:21 -07:00
git-prune.txt
git-pull.txt
git-push.txt add --porcelain option to git-push 2009-06-27 22:26:58 -07:00
git-quiltimport.txt
git-read-tree.txt read-tree: migrate to parse-options 2009-06-27 14:11:28 -07:00
git-rebase.txt am, rebase: teach quiet option 2009-06-18 11:54:48 -07:00
git-receive-pack.txt
git-reflog.txt
git-relink.txt
git-remote.txt git remote update: Fallback to remote if group does not exist 2009-04-07 21:52:26 -07:00
git-repack.txt git-repack.txt: Clarify implications of -a for dumb protocols 2009-06-09 23:47:49 -07:00
git-repo-config.txt
git-request-pull.txt
git-rerere.txt git-rerere.txt: Clarify ambiguity of the config variable 2009-07-28 13:30:42 -07:00
git-reset.txt
git-rev-list.txt git-rev-list.txt: Clarify the use of multiple revision arguments 2009-08-06 13:33:52 -07:00
git-rev-parse.txt parse-opt: make PARSE_OPT_STOP_AT_NON_OPTION available to git rev-parse 2009-06-13 17:08:37 -07:00
git-revert.txt
git-rm.txt
git-send-email.txt Documentation: git-send-email: correct statement about standard ports 2009-07-31 11:22:50 -07:00
git-send-pack.txt
git-sh-setup.txt
git-shell.txt git-shell: Add 'git-upload-archive' to allowed commands. 2009-04-11 11:01:15 -07:00
git-shortlog.txt
git-show-branch.txt git-merge-base/git-show-branch --merge-base: Documentation and test 2009-08-05 10:29:37 -07:00
git-show-index.txt
git-show-ref.txt show-ref: migrate to parse-options 2009-06-20 23:50:42 -07:00
git-show.txt
git-stage.txt
git-stash.txt Document 'stash clear' recovery via unreachable commits 2009-08-09 18:33:41 -07:00
git-status.txt
git-stripspace.txt
git-submodule.txt Documentation: git submodule: add missing options to synopsis 2009-08-05 12:36:38 -07:00
git-svn.txt git svn: revert default behavior for --minimize-url 2009-07-25 04:09:43 -07:00
git-symbolic-ref.txt
git-tag.txt git-tag(1): Refer to git-check-ref-format(1) for <name> 2009-08-06 13:33:57 -07:00
git-tar-tree.txt
git-tools.txt
git-unpack-file.txt
git-unpack-objects.txt
git-update-index.txt
git-update-ref.txt
git-update-server-info.txt Remove obsolete bug warning in man git-update-server-info 2009-04-25 09:29:38 -07:00
git-upload-archive.txt
git-upload-pack.txt
git-var.txt
git-verify-pack.txt verify-pack: migrate to parse-options 2009-07-10 23:57:20 -07:00
git-verify-tag.txt
git-web--browse.txt
git-whatchanged.txt
git-write-tree.txt
git.txt GIT 1.6.4 2009-07-29 00:32:42 -07:00
gitattributes.txt doc/gitattributes: clarify location of config text 2009-04-17 21:28:07 -07:00
gitcli.txt Documentation: remove extra quoting/emphasis around literal texts 2009-03-17 14:16:44 -07:00
gitcore-tutorial.txt
gitcvs-migration.txt gitcvs-migration: Link to git-cvsimport documentation 2009-04-20 13:45:02 -07:00
gitdiffcore.txt
gitglossary.txt
githooks.txt githooks documentation: post-checkout hook is also called after clone 2009-03-22 12:29:47 -07:00
gitignore.txt Documentation: clarify .gitattributes search 2009-04-07 21:58:25 -07:00
gitk.txt Documentation: Expand a couple of abbreviations 2009-03-03 21:42:44 -08:00
gitmodules.txt git-submodule: add support for --merge. 2009-06-03 00:09:16 -07:00
gitrepository-layout.txt
gittutorial-2.txt
gittutorial.txt Makes some cleanup/review in gittutorial 2009-06-30 11:17:55 -07:00
gitworkflows.txt
glossary-content.txt Documentation: Introduce "upstream branch" 2009-04-07 22:04:41 -07:00
howto-index.sh
i18n.txt
install-doc-quick.sh
install-webdoc.sh
mailmap.txt Documentation: minor grammatical fixes in git-blame.txt. 2009-03-17 12:08:43 -07:00
Makefile Disable asciidoc 8.4.1+ semantics for {plus} and friends 2009-07-25 10:07:06 -07:00
manpage-1.72.xsl Documentation: move quieting params into manpage-base.xsl 2009-03-27 00:33:19 -07:00
manpage-base.xsl Documentation: use "spurious .sp" XSLT if DOCBOOK_SUPPRESS_SP is set 2009-04-01 11:02:42 -07:00
manpage-bold-literal.xsl Documentation: option to render literal text as bold for manpages 2009-03-27 00:33:20 -07:00
manpage-normal.xsl Documentation: move "spurious .sp" code into manpage-base.xsl 2009-03-27 00:33:19 -07:00
manpage-suppress-sp.xsl Documentation: use "spurious .sp" XSLT if DOCBOOK_SUPPRESS_SP is set 2009-04-01 11:02:42 -07:00
merge-config.txt mergetool--lib: add support for araxis merge 2009-05-24 11:21:05 -07:00
merge-options.txt merge-options.txt: Clarify merge --squash 2009-05-25 11:23:18 -07:00
merge-strategies.txt Grammar fixes to "merge" and "patch-id" docs 2009-03-25 17:28:33 -07:00
pretty-formats.txt pretty.c: add %f format specifier to format_commit_message() 2009-03-22 21:32:13 -07:00
pretty-options.txt Add --oneline that is a synonym to "--pretty=oneline --abbrev-commit" 2009-02-24 23:53:40 -08:00
pull-fetch-param.txt
RelNotes-1.5.0.1.txt
RelNotes-1.5.0.2.txt
RelNotes-1.5.0.3.txt
RelNotes-1.5.0.4.txt
RelNotes-1.5.0.5.txt
RelNotes-1.5.0.6.txt
RelNotes-1.5.0.7.txt
RelNotes-1.5.0.txt
RelNotes-1.5.1.1.txt
RelNotes-1.5.1.2.txt
RelNotes-1.5.1.3.txt
RelNotes-1.5.1.4.txt
RelNotes-1.5.1.5.txt
RelNotes-1.5.1.6.txt
RelNotes-1.5.1.txt
RelNotes-1.5.2.1.txt
RelNotes-1.5.2.2.txt Documentation: Typos / spelling fixes in RelNotes 2009-03-03 21:40:36 -08:00
RelNotes-1.5.2.3.txt
RelNotes-1.5.2.4.txt
RelNotes-1.5.2.5.txt
RelNotes-1.5.2.txt
RelNotes-1.5.3.1.txt
RelNotes-1.5.3.2.txt
RelNotes-1.5.3.3.txt
RelNotes-1.5.3.4.txt
RelNotes-1.5.3.5.txt
RelNotes-1.5.3.6.txt
RelNotes-1.5.3.7.txt
RelNotes-1.5.3.8.txt
RelNotes-1.5.3.txt
RelNotes-1.5.4.1.txt
RelNotes-1.5.4.2.txt
RelNotes-1.5.4.3.txt
RelNotes-1.5.4.4.txt
RelNotes-1.5.4.5.txt
RelNotes-1.5.4.6.txt
RelNotes-1.5.4.7.txt
RelNotes-1.5.4.txt
RelNotes-1.5.5.1.txt
RelNotes-1.5.5.2.txt
RelNotes-1.5.5.3.txt
RelNotes-1.5.5.4.txt
RelNotes-1.5.5.5.txt
RelNotes-1.5.5.6.txt
RelNotes-1.5.5.txt
RelNotes-1.5.6.1.txt
RelNotes-1.5.6.2.txt
RelNotes-1.5.6.3.txt
RelNotes-1.5.6.4.txt
RelNotes-1.5.6.5.txt
RelNotes-1.5.6.6.txt
RelNotes-1.5.6.txt
RelNotes-1.6.0.1.txt
RelNotes-1.6.0.2.txt Documentation: Typos / spelling fixes in RelNotes 2009-03-03 21:40:36 -08:00
RelNotes-1.6.0.3.txt
RelNotes-1.6.0.4.txt
RelNotes-1.6.0.5.txt
RelNotes-1.6.0.6.txt
RelNotes-1.6.0.txt
RelNotes-1.6.1.1.txt Documentation: Typos / spelling fixes in RelNotes 2009-03-03 21:40:36 -08:00
RelNotes-1.6.1.2.txt Documentation: Typos / spelling fixes in RelNotes 2009-03-03 21:40:36 -08:00
RelNotes-1.6.1.3.txt
RelNotes-1.6.1.4.txt GIT 1.6.1.4 2009-05-03 15:29:31 -07:00
RelNotes-1.6.1.txt
RelNotes-1.6.2.1.txt GIT 1.6.2.1 2009-03-15 13:05:05 -07:00
RelNotes-1.6.2.2.txt GIT 1.6.2.2 2009-04-02 12:34:16 -07:00
RelNotes-1.6.2.3.txt GIT 1.6.2.3 2009-04-12 15:57:58 -07:00
RelNotes-1.6.2.4.txt GIT 1.6.2.4 2009-04-19 17:34:26 -07:00
RelNotes-1.6.2.5.txt GIT 1.6.2.5 2009-05-03 16:54:14 -07:00
RelNotes-1.6.2.txt GIT 1.6.2 2009-03-03 23:37:19 -08:00
RelNotes-1.6.3.1.txt GIT 1.6.3.1 2009-05-12 22:30:29 -07:00
RelNotes-1.6.3.2.txt GIT 1.6.3.2 2009-06-03 22:47:48 -07:00
RelNotes-1.6.3.3.txt GIT 1.6.3.3 2009-06-21 21:15:50 -07:00
RelNotes-1.6.3.4.txt GIT 1.6.3.4 2009-07-28 23:59:30 -07:00
RelNotes-1.6.3.txt GIT 1.6.3 2009-05-06 18:16:40 -07:00
RelNotes-1.6.4.txt GIT 1.6.4 2009-07-29 00:32:42 -07:00
RelNotes-1.6.5.txt Start 1.6.5 cycle 2009-07-29 09:33:29 -07:00
rev-list-options.txt Document 'git (rev-list|log) --merges' 2009-07-13 11:09:41 -07:00
SubmittingPatches SubmittingPatches: itemize and reflect upon well written changes 2009-04-28 00:40:00 -07:00
urls-remotes.txt Allow push and fetch urls to be different 2009-06-09 23:46:47 -07:00
urls.txt
user-manual.conf
user-manual.txt Documentation: teach stash/pop workflow instead of stash/apply 2009-05-30 22:21:29 -07:00